Athlete’s foot is actually a fungal infection which is contagious. It is usually referred to as tinea pedis and is brought on by the trichophyton fungus. Probably the most common reasons an individual becomes infected is when the feet are exposed to moist environments just like in the restroom, floors of locker rooms and also airtight shoes.

Most of the common athlete’s foot symptoms are itching, flaking, redness as well as scaling on the sole of the feet or maybe between the toes. In serious cases, cracks will appear, the nails can divide, blisters and red wounds can develop.

Vinegar for athlete’s foot

Vinegar You can actually use vinegar as a home remedy for athlete’s foot. Vinegar is highly acidic and very effectively kills the fungi. Apply it by either soaking cotton pads in it afterwards on your skin, or if totally possible by soaking your skin in water to which you have put in 3 cups of it.

Oregano oil for athlete’s foot

Oil of oregano You can even make use of oil of oregano in place of tea tree oil. Oil of oregano has carvacrol which has anti fungal, anti parasitic, anti bacterial, anti viral and anti septic properties.

Alcohol for athlete’s foot

Alcohol A very strong disinfectant, it can also be used in a combination with vinegar or solely. Dip cotton balls in alcohol and apply exactly the same strategy you would vinegar. To combine it with some vinegar, add a 1/2 cup of it and 1 cup of vinegar to water.

Boudreaux’s Butt Paste

Boudreaux’s Butt Paste A good diaper rash cream which has had a very high level of zinc oxide can also be effective in drying the area out. It’s actually a good treatment to alternate with in between anti-fungal creams and to keep it from reoccurring.

Black tea

Black tea Try to use black tea mix with water to soak your feet and toes. Black tea has tannic acid that has the ability to kill the fungus in addition to producing a relaxing effect.

Salt for athlete’s foot

Salt Put 1 to 1.5 cups of salt to water and soak your toes. The water could be at room temperature or ideally a lukewarm.

Grapefruit seed extract

Grapefruit seed extract Many experts have proven it to have strong anti-fungal effects. The easiest way to make use of this extract is to apply a few drops to the palm and rub it into the feet 2 or 3 times daily. Grapefruit seed extract can even be put into the washing machine while washing socks.

Probiotics

Probiotics Having a probiotic supplement for 3 months or longer can frequently assist in preventing the infection from coming back again, because most fungal infections take place because your body doesn’t have sufficient good bacteria to help keep them out.

Apply bleach for athlete’s foot

Another funny athletes foot home remedy is to advise applying bleach, if you’re curious about it safetyness of using bleach for athlete’s foot the answer is definitely no! A lot of people are sensitive to the strong chemicals plus it can damage the skin. This may even damage the broken skin causing more harm than good.
